.jpg)
向服务组件架构出发
SAP的Java EE软件架构师及SCA-J技术委员会联合主席Henning Blohm,将服务组件架构视为一种跨技术(cross-technology)的编程模型集成。他认为:对于厂商,SCA降低了给它的用户提供实现或绑定的边际成本;对于用户,SCA减少了使用它们的边际成本。
.jpg)
SAP的Java EE软件架构师及SCA-J技术委员会联合主席Henning Blohm,将服务组件架构视为一种跨技术(cross-technology)的编程模型集成。他认为:对于厂商,SCA降低了给它的用户提供实现或绑定的边际成本;对于用户,SCA减少了使用它们的边际成本。

你是否想要有一个工具既简单方便地被我们所使用,也不需要自己再写xml文件,还要为我们提供已定制好的所有常用的构建命令,又能够为我们快速地把它和主流的集成开发工具Eclipse一起工作?更进一步地,把构建命令作为一个程序Java程序来进行开发,如果你想扩展你的构建命令的话?下面我们就来介绍一种这样的软件构建系统EL4Ant。该工具来自于现实的软件开发项目,也希望能为你的实际工作服务。
ADP的高级技术架构师Nicholas Whitehead在IBM developerWorks上发表了由三部分组成的文章系列,题为Java运行时监控,该系列文章详细讨论了现代应用性能管理(APM)解决方案中使用的策略。
在年初收购BEA之后,Oracle首次发布了其应用服务器的最新版本WebLogic Server 10g R3。该版本支持Java SE 6、Spring、Comet、改进的Operations Control、FastSwap Deployment及更多特性。
自由软件最近发布了Jt 2.6(Java模式框架),这个面向模式的开源框架在最新版本中改进了JtWizard,增强了Jt组件(Jt Components)。JtWizard可用于生成基于设计模式的Java应用,这些设计模式包括四人帮(GoF)、数据访问对象(DAO)、模型-视图-控制器(MVC)和J2EE设计模式。
JSR-315 (Servlet 3.0)的草案规范已经公布,它引入了许多新特性,包括对异步/Comet的支持,以及其他能够简化开发的特征,比如更多的Annotation(注释)和web.xml片段。同时,有一些新特征引发了相当激烈的争论,专家组正在积极地寻求社区的反馈。
Oracle的Cameron Purdy最近在JavaOne 2008大会上作了一个关于可伸缩性的演讲。和其它大部分主要关注于具体Java类库的演讲不同的是,他从实际的角度谈到了软件架构和设计的一般原则。